Bloom From Within is a mixed media collage I created for a brief in my Design Research Project subject, completed in third year. The brief tasked us with the challenge of creating a poster that represented the essence of our self identity.

The medium of mixed media was explored, as it allowed me to use multiple layers and materials that visually represent the multiple and intricate layers to my personality. The final piece showcases a harmonious, yet chaotic mix of hand drawn illustrations, digitally rendered illustrations, and magazine cutouts, merging physical processes with digital, to take the audience on a journey of self identity in my third year of university.

The warm, inviting color palette employed in "Bloom From Within" adds an extra layer of depth to the piece, creating a visual warmth that resonates with the core of my identity. Through this artwork, I wanted to convey that my self-identity is not a static concept but rather a dynamic and evolving mosaic of experiences, passions, and expressions, and I hope it inspires the audience to reflect on their own.
